------- Additional comments from [EMAIL PROTECTED] Wed Feb 16 09:44:52 -0800 2005 ------- The problem is that the current temp URL is written to the InternalOptions so that on destruction of this object it tries to write it to the configuration, but this was disposed already or maybe the exception is misleading and the problem is that no write access was available. BTW: I see a problem if several configuration items are created *before* the user data has been created because I can't see how they can get a write access.
